    LJC-2605. Too much Magenta.

    Hi fellows,

    A customer has this LJC-2605 and he tried a generic magenta cartridge (trying to save some money) with bad results. The others cartridges are OEM.

    He decided it was no good and bought and installed a brand new HP M-Crtdg.

    However, now he gets the right half of the page all covered with magenta toner. The left side looks clean.

    I cleaned and inspected the printer but could not find anything wrong with it. The first page looks pretty bad, but by the third or fourth page it has cleaned up good enough to be usable. It seems to be kind of erratic, and it happens only with the magenta. Black pages look good.

    What could be happening here?
